Does the UK MBA budget of 35 lakhs include living expenses?
It depends. A budget of ₹35 lakhs (about £35,000) for an MBA in the UK can cover both tuition and living expenses at some universities, but not all.
- Top-tier universities: Tuition alone is typically £55,000 - £75,000, so ₹35 lakhs will not be enough.
- Mid-range/regional universities: Tuition ranges from £15,000 - £40,000. In less expensive cities, living costs are about £12,000 - £18,000/year, so your budget may be sufficient here.
